As soon as slated to grow to be a bus lane and enterprise suites alongside US 1 south of Dadeland Mall, Rockland Pineland Protect now protectes a mostly-vanished pure habitat.
It’s a snapshot of the intensive pine rocklands that after lined a lot of the uplands within the Miami metro.
Thought-about for conservation since 1985, the parcel was almost developed earlier than biologists found a uncommon endemic plant. That discovery led to acquisition with the assistance of state funding.
Resulting from distinctive geography and overlapping floristic areas, these pine rocklands host dozens of uncommon species and a curious mixture of tropical and temperate vegetation.
A easy, vast path cuts by the middle of the protect, offering a simple out-and-back route whereas immersing guests inside pure landscapes.

Starting on the north trailhead, head eastward on a large double monitor main into the forest.
Clusters of ferns line the path alongside cabbage palms and columns of South Florida slash pine.

North entranceLocustberry, wild poinsettia, and porterweed sprout from dense carpets of pine duff the place atala butterflies search out the nectar of button sage, a local lantana.
A number of interpretive indicators alongside the route describe pure options of the protect and the significance of standard burns on this hearth dependent neighborhood.

Atala butterfly on a lantanaReaching 0.2 mile, a path marker signifies a proper flip onto a rocky grade flanked by numerous grasses.
Close by, tall posts fitted with wire platforms rise above the cover to accommodate nesting raptors.

Raptor nesting platformHeading southward, an intriguing ridge parallels the path, minimize out from the substrate when development had begun on a highway that was by no means accomplished.
Though unnatural, this outcropping supplies a novel alternative to see a cross part of the limestone beneath the floor.

Uncovered limestoneNearing a half mile, the path enters a shady cover of untamed tamarind timber earlier than reaching the south entrance to the protect.
Flip round at this level, retracing your footsteps for 0.6 mile again to the north trailhead.
